Our Lake City units run truck-mount extraction pumps that pull thousands of gallons per hour, cutting standing-water time from days to hours. Every extraction job includes moisture mapping so we know exactly which materials are still holding water once the visible flooding is gone.
We place industrial dehumidifiers and air movers based on actual psychrometric calculations, not a standard equipment count per room, with daily drying logs so you can see the numbers improving, not just take our word for it.

Standing water comes out first; drying equipment gets placed only after we've mapped exactly where moisture is hiding.
We re-check moisture levels daily until materials hit dry standard, then hand you full documentation for your records or your insurer.

Drying time varies with material and how quickly extraction started, but 3 to 5 days is typical for most Lake City jobs.
Not if it's addressed quickly — mold generally needs 24-48 hours of sustained moisture, which is exactly why fast extraction matters.
